How Humidity Destroys Bathroom Vanities: A Quick Primer

Wood and engineered wood products respond to moisture in predictable—and often destructive—ways. When humidity rises, wood fibers absorb water vapor and expand. When the air dries out, they contract. Repeated cycles cause warping, cracking, delamination, and joint failure.

According to ASTM D4933, a standard guide for moisture conditioning of wood and wood-based materials, equilibrium moisture content is critical for dimensional stability—solid wood in a bathroom will continuously try to equilibrate with ambient humidity, which leads to constant movement. Solid Wood Bathroom Vanity: Timeless Beauty with Strings Attached

Why Homeowners Love Solid Wood

Solid wood offers unmatched natural grain, warmth, and the ability to be sanded and refinished multiple times over decades. A well-maintained solid oak or teak vanity can outlive the house it sits in.

I recently inspected a white oak bathroom vanity in a poorly ventilated guest bathroom—after three years, the finish had worn near the sink basin, but the wood underneath remained sound because the homeowner had applied marine-grade varnish to all six sides before installation. That extra step made all the difference.

The Real Challenge: Wood Movement

Here's the problem: solid wood never stops moving. ASTM D143 testing protocols measure how wood species respond to moisture changes, and the data is clear—different species move at different rates. White oak and teak are among the most stable, with tight grain and natural oils that resist moisture absorption. Pine, cherry, and poplar are poor choices for bathrooms.

From experience, the most common failure point on solid wood bathroom vanities isn't the visible panels—it's the drawer joints. When dovetail joints repeatedly expand and contract, they loosen over time. I've seen three-year-old pine vanities where drawers no longer close squarely because the wood movement loosened every joint.

Maintenance Reality Check

A solid wood bathroom vanity requires resealing every 2–3 years with a moisture-cured urethane or marine varnish. If you skip this maintenance, water penetrates the finish, the wood swells, and the damage is often irreversible. In a primary bathroom used daily by a family of four, expect to refinish every 18–24 months.

Plywood Bathroom Vanity: The Smart Performance Choice

Engineered for Stability

Plywood is constructed from multiple thin veneers laid in alternating grain directions and bonded with moisture-resistant adhesive. This cross-graining nearly eliminates the dimensional movement that plagues solid wood. According to plywood grading standards, high-quality cabinet-grade plywood uses MR (moisture-resistant) or WBP (weather and boil proof) glue formulations, with marine-grade plywood offering the highest level of water resistance.

Real-World Performance: A Case Study

Last year, a client in coastal South Carolina—where ambient humidity rarely drops below 60%—asked me to recommend a material for their beach house bathroom vanity. After discussing options, we chose 3/4-inch marine-grade plywood for the cabinet box with solid wood drawer fronts. Two years later, during a post-hurricane inspection, the plywood structure showed zero swelling, while a nearby solid pine vanity installed by the previous owner had already delaminated at the base joints.

What to Look For in Plywood

Not all plywood is created equal for bathroom use. Here's what you need:

BWP (Boiling Water Proof) or marine grade: These use phenolic resins and pass rigorous boiling water tests—they can withstand continuous moisture exposure.

MR50 or MR100 rated plywood: Designed for humid environments with measured swell resistance meeting ANSI standards.

Finish all cut edges: Even marine plywood will wick moisture through exposed end grain. Seal every cut edge with waterproof wood hardener or marine epoxy before installation.

MDF Bathroom Vanity: Budget-Friendly but Vulnerable

The Smooth Surface Advantage

MDF (Medium-Density Fiberboard) is made from wood fibers compressed with resin. Its primary advantage is a perfectly smooth, uniform surface that accepts paint beautifully—no grain telegraphing through. This makes MDF the go-to material for painted bathroom vanities in modern and transitional styles.

The Moisture Problem

Here's the hard truth: standard MDF absorbs moisture like a sponge and swells irreversibly. According to material specifications, even moisture-resistant MDF grades like MR50 are formulated to endure humid conditions but are not fully waterproof—and any unsealed edge remains vulnerable.

I once repaired an MDF bathroom vanity for a neighbor whose teenage daughter left a wet washcloth draped over the cabinet door for just three weeks. The MDF at the bottom edge of the door had swollen to twice its original thickness, and the door would no longer close. The damage was permanent—there's no sanding MDF back into shape once it swells.

When MDF Makes Sense

If you're on a tight budget, renting out a property, or installing a vanity in a half-bath with no shower, an MDF bathroom vanity with fully sealed edges and high-quality paint can work. The key is preventing any moisture from reaching the core—which means sealing every cut, using silicone at all joints, and maintaining excellent bathroom ventilation.

Side-by-Side Comparison: Durability, Cost & Maintenance

 Factor Solid Wood Plywood MDF
Moisture resistance Moderate (species-dependent) High (grade-dependent) Low to moderate
Warping risk High if not properly sealed Very low Low (but swells instead)
Repair ability Excellent (sand and refinish) Moderate Poor (swelling is permanent)
Initial cost (30-inch single vanity) $800–$2,500+ $500–$1,200 $250–$600
Lifespan in primary bathroom (properly maintained) 15–25+ years 20–30+ years 5–10 years
Annual maintenance Sealing/refinishing Minimal (clean only) Minimal

What Does Water Damage Cost? A Hard Look at the Numbers

The average cost to restore a water-damaged bathroom ranges from $2,000 to $6,000, covering dry-out services, mold remediation, and material replacement. If your bathroom vanity fails and water seeps behind it into the wall cavity or subfloor, those costs escalate quickly.

I've seen homeowners try to save $200 upfront by buying an MDF bathroom vanity only to spend $1,500 on repairs 18 months later when a slow drip from the sink drain went unnoticed and turned the MDF cabinet base into mush. A high-quality plywood vanity would have survived that same drip with minimal damage.

How to Extend Any Bathroom Vanity's Life: Pro Tips

Regardless of which material you choose, these practices dramatically improve longevity:

Run the exhaust fan for at least 30 minutes after every shower to keep relative humidity below 60%.

Seal all cut edges—backs, drawer cutouts, and shelf edges—with waterproof wood hardener or marine epoxy before installation.

Elevate the vanity base 4–6 inches off the floor on metal legs or glides to allow airflow underneath.

Use an undermount sink with a solid surface countertop so water can't pool at the sink edge and seep into the cabinet.

Apply silicone caulk along the back edge where the vanity meets the wall and around the sink cutout.

Expert Verdict: Which Bathroom Vanity Material Lasts Longest?

After evaluating real-world performance data and years of field experience, here's the clear ranking for high-humidity bathrooms:

  • Marine-grade or BWP plywood – Superior dimensional stability, excellent moisture resistance, moderate cost, and minimal maintenance requirements make plywood the undisputed winner for longevity in wet environments. The cross-layered construction naturally resists warping, and phenolic resin binders withstand boiling water tests.
  • Solid wood (select species only) – White oak, teak, walnut, and cypress can last generations with proper sealing and maintenance. However, the ongoing upkeep requirement and vulnerability to poor ventilation knock solid wood out of the top spot for most homeowners.
  • MR-rated moisture-resistant MDF – Acceptable for powder rooms, rental properties, or low-use bathrooms where budget is the primary constraint. Never install standard MDF in a bathroom with a shower or tub.

FAQs

How long should a bathroom vanity last in a high-humidity bathroom?

A properly maintained plywood or solid wood bathroom vanity should last 15–25 years in a primary bathroom. MDF vanities typically last 5–10 years under the same conditions before showing swelling or delamination.

Can I use solid wood for a bathroom vanity if my bathroom has poor ventilation?

Not recommended. Without adequate ventilation, humidity levels stay elevated, and even sealed solid wood will absorb moisture over time, leading to warping and joint failure. Plywood is a better choice for poorly ventilated bathrooms.

What's the difference between MR plywood and marine-grade plywood?

MR (moisture-resistant) plywood uses urea-formaldehyde resin and handles moderate humidity but not standing water. Marine-grade (BWP) plywood uses phenolic resin and passes boiling water tests, making it fully waterproof and ideal for bathrooms.

Is moisture-resistant MDF worth the extra cost over standard MDF?

Yes, if you must use MDF. MR50-rated MDF is formulated to endure humid conditions without swelling as quickly as standard MDF. However, it still requires sealed edges and cannot withstand direct water contact.

How often should I reseal a solid wood bathroom vanity?

Every 2–3 years for most species, or every 12–18 months for high-use primary bathrooms. Use a moisture-cured urethane or marine-grade varnish for best protection.

Which wood species is best for a solid wood bathroom vanity?

White oak is the top choice for its tight grain and natural tannins that resist moisture. Teak is excellent but expensive. Walnut works well. Avoid pine, cherry, and poplar in bathrooms.

Can a water-damaged MDF bathroom vanity be repaired?

Usually not. MDF swells permanently when wet, and sanding only damages the surface further. The affected panel or door typically needs full replacement.

Does plywood bathroom vanity need special maintenance?

No—that's one of its key advantages. Keep the vanity clean and dry, seal any exposed cut edges, and address leaks promptly. No annual refinishing is required.
